- Cardiff sightings placed Quentin Tarantino and Kylie Minogue together on a film set, though the project itself was not identified.
- No tenth feature is expected from Tarantino, prompting speculation the shoot could be a commercial or music video rather than a new film.
- The director recently relocated to the UK while preparing “The Popinjay Cavalier,” a swashbuckling comedy set in the 1830s.
- That play is slated to open in London’s West End in early 2027, with no cast announced yet.
